Macfarlanes PEP Breaks Through £2M As Profits, Revenue Also Jump
The firm's profit per equity partner is now higher than elite rival Allen & Overy's.
July 27, 2021 at 04:42 AM
2 minute read
Law Firm ProfitabilityMacfarlanes has joined the U.K. law firms announcing bumper results, with its revenue, profits and and profit per equity partner (PEP) all leaping in the 2020/21 financial year.
